I parked in front of The Grill one game day at probably 8am, (obviously when College St was still open there) had breakfast at The Grill, went to the game, came back to a parking ticket after the game about 4pm I guess. The ticket was somewhere around $25, I think. This was probably 10 years ago, can't say what your results would be today but it was cheap parking for me.

They dont boot unless you rack up 3+ tickets unpaid. They dont tow unless there’s a street event and signs for you to not park are up. Just be weary of open container anywhere off campus- the cops will ticket you for that.
